Man sentenced five years for arson

Court Reporter
A 30-year-old man from Fort Rixon in Insiza District has been sentenced to five years in prison for arson after he torched his younger brother’s hut in revenge as he had impregnated his girlfriend. Vusa Dube of Wessels 1PBS torched Mr Gift Dube’s hut destroying property valued at $1 500.
Dube was convicted on his own plea of guilty when he appeared before Bulawayo magistrate Mr Abednico Ndebele yesterday.
He would serve an effective 40 months after one year was suspended for five years on condition of good behaviour while a further eight months were suspended on condition that he compensates his younger brother.

The property that was burnt included a bed, cupboard, couch and electrical gadgets.
Mr Kudakwashe Jaravaza, for the State, told the court that on Sunday, Dube told his mother that he wanted to kill his younger brother because he had impregnated his girlfriend.

He told the mother that in the event that he failed to kill his younger brother, he would torch his bedroom hut because he was on a mission to revenge.

At about 11pm, Dube torched the hut using a match stick and fled from the scene.
He was arrested on Monday morning while preparing to leave his homestead as he intended to flee to South Africa.
Dube denied that he wanted to run away and told the court that he acted out of anger.

He pleaded with the court to be lenient with him, saying he was willing to reconstruct his brother’s hut and compensate him for the property.
